COASTAL QUEEN Restoration Project – Episode 10 – Structure


Follow along with Peter Slack’s ongoing series about the restoration of COASTAL QUEEN, a Chesapeake Bay Buy Boat built in 1928 and modified in the late 1950s to a cruising yacht. The series follows the process from the bottom up, as a new keel, keelson and cross planking are needed to support this massive structure.

October 7, 2022 – COASTAL QUEEN Restoration Project – Episode 10: Structure

Bottom planking, after the new keel and keelson have been attached. Planks are cut and dry fit in some cases…as the boat structure keeps tightening…
